Received odd and slightly creepy package/gift with card at our front door. Anyone know who or what might be behind this? Grandview Heights. by danimalforlife in Columbus

[–]KeyEmergency6085 5 points6 points  (0 children)

Samaritan's Purse is an Evangelical Outreach that provides services and other material items globally. Their whole gimmick is to give out these services, hoping people will convert to Christianity. They ramp up during Christmas time with their Outreach. What I assume happened is that a kid, tasked by their church, left this as a means of "being nice" and "spreading the gospel."

Growing up in the church, we were challenged to do these types of "witnessing" activities. I assume the kid was given the calendar to give to a neighbor, and the lubricant was just something they had on hand to "gift."
